How they compare
Belgium currently reports 49.18 deaths against 44 deaths in Papua New Guinea, a difference of 5.18 deaths.
That makes Belgium's figure about 1.1 times Papua New Guinea's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 22 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Belgium ahead.
Belgium ranks 93rd and Papua New Guinea ranks 96th of 194 countries.
Belgium has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
